Mexican Style Beef And Rice
From silverqueen 15 years agoIngredients
- 1 lb. Publix lean ground beef shopping list
- 1 cup Publix Long Drain rice shopping list
- 1 cups water shopping list
- 1 (16-oz.) jar Publix Mild All-natural chunky salsa shopping list
- 1 (15-oz.) can Publix black beans In seasoned Sauce (undrained) shopping list
- 1-1/2 cups Publix Four-cheese Mexican-Blend Shredded cheese shopping list
How to make it
- Place ground beef in a large sate pan and cook 7 minutes, stirring to crumble or until meat is browned and no pink remains.
- Drain ground beef and return to pan, stir in rice and water.
- Bring to a boil
- Reduce heat cover and cook on low for 10 minutes.
- Stir in salsa and beans, cover and cook 8 more minutes or until rice is tender.
- Sprinkle with cheese, cover and cook 3 more minutes or until cheese melts.
